Code B210A Nissan Description

There are 2 switches in the steering unit. The Intelligent Power Distribution Module (IPDM) Engine Room (E/R) compares those 2 switches conditions to judge the present steering status and transmit the result to Body Control Module (BCM) via the Controlled Area Network (CAN) communication.

What are the Possible Causes of the DTC B210A Nissan?

  • Faulty Steering Lock Condition Switch
  • Steering Lock Condition Switch harness is open or shorted
  • Steering Lock Condition Switch circuit poor electrical connection
  • Faulty Intelligent Power Distribution Module (IPDM)

How to Fix the DTC B210A Nissan?

Review the 'Possible Causes' above and visually examine the corresponding wiring harness and connectors. Check for damaged components and inspect connector pins for signs of being broken, bent, pushed out, or corroded.

What is the Cost to Diagnose the Code?

Labor: 1.0

To diagnose the B210A Nissan code, it typically requires 1.0 hour of labor. Rates vary by location, vehicle, and shop. Many shops charge between $80–$150 per hour; dealerships and metro areas may be higher, independents may be lower.
